The reason for adding your Epic Games copy of Returnal to Steam is that it allows you to use the Steam configuration tool with non-Steam games making it extremely easy to get your controller to work.

Select Add a Non-Steam Game to My Library.If you purchased Returnal on the Epic Games Store you can still follow the same process with an additional step: Click the OK button to close out the Steam settings window.Click the PlayStation Configuration Support check box.Click the Controller tab from the side bar menu.After that, you will then need to follow the below steps because Steam doesn’t natively support controller use: To do this, you must plug your DualSense Controller into your PC using the USB-C to USB cable. To achieve haptic feedback and dynamic trigger effects in Returnal, you need to use a wired connection to experience the full range of in-game controller features.
